Cookies

If you leave a comment on our site you may opt-in to saving your name, email address and website in cookies. These are for your convenience so that you do not have to fill in your details again when you leave another comment. These cookies will last for one year.

If you visit our login page, we will set a temporary cookie to determine if your browser accepts cookies. This cookie contains no personal data and is discarded when you close your browser.

When you log in, we will also set up several cookies to save your login information and your screen display choices. Login cookies last for two days, and screen options cookies last for a year. If you select “Remember Me”, your login will persist for two weeks. If you log out of your account, the login cookies will be removed.

If you edit or publish an article, an additional cookie will be saved in your browser. This cookie includes no personal data and simply indicates the post ID of the article you just edited. It expires after 1 day.

How we protect your data

Much of the information we hold about you will be stored electronically in a secure data centre located in Australia. We use a range of physical, electronic and other security measures to protect the security, confidentiality and integrity of the personal information we hold.

Strict control is applied to ensure organisations will only have access to relevant data and not beyond. Records are obtained via secure channels – whether it be FTP/API/removable media devices. Staging environments such as FTP server is periodically cleansed to prevent sensitive data from lingering. Removable media devices are kept in a secure locked location. Only authorised staff will have controlled access to client information/records. The records must be encrypted while in transit and at rest. This covers all physical media such as storage disks, backup media, and removable media (USB flash drives, external drives, CD/DVDs). When records are being requested for removal, ensure all associated access methods are terminated. Ensure all running electronic storage are cleaned. Ensure all removable media containing the requested data is destroyed. The exclusion are backups. We will not retrospectively clean up backups.
